Railway station
Roslyn is a station on the Oyster Bay Branch of the Long Island Rail Road. It is located at Lincoln & Railroad Avenues, west of Roslyn Road and south of Warner Avenue, in , , . is situated 1 mile northeast of Nassau County Basin #289.

Railway station
Albertson is a station on the Long Island Rail Road's Oyster Bay Branch. The station is on the north side of I.U. Willets Road at Albertson Avenue on the border, in , . is situated 1 mile southeast of Nassau County Basin #289.
